ORDER
(1) A learned Single Judge of this Court in a batch of cases in Crl.O.P.No.28458/2019 etc., batch, [Dr.Padmanathan and Others Vs. Tmt. Monica and Others] vide common order dated 18.01.2021, had very categorically held that any proceedings questioning the pendency of complaints preferred under the Protection of Women from Domestic Violence Act, 2005, should only be preferred as a Civil Revision Petition under Article 227 of the Constitution of India and that the petition under Section 482 of Cr.P.C., would not lie and the same is not maintainable. (2) Additionally, the learned counsel for the petitioner states that the matter has been settled.
